SERVICENOW LAUNCHES NEW AI TOOL TO ENHANCE EMPLOYEE EXPERIENCE

Source | www.unleashgroup.io | JENNIFER DUNKERLEY

  • Big data and automation continue to be key areas of focus for enhancing employee experience.
  • Worldwide digital transformation investments will total more than $7.8 trillion by 2024.
  • Nearly 80% of the Fortune 500 and thousands of organizations worldwide currently use ServiceNow’s Now Platform, including Nike, Adobe, Logitech, and more

ServiceNow has launched a major expansion of its digital employee experience platform. Today’s Quebec release includes brand new workflow innovations for listening, productivity, and single service requests.

Further cementing the notion that the world of work is accelerating at record-pace into a new digital future, employee experience has become a key competitive differentiator, extending the realms of HR into legal, workplace services, and more.

The new Quebec launch updates ServiceNow’s popular existing Now Platform to include automated enhancements for employee experience, notably a real-time listening tool to collect data on employee sentiment, happiness, and productivity.

The updates that enhance the employee experience include:

  • Universal Request: This provides employees with a single service experience across departments and enables cross-departmental collaboration to speed up resolution times for employees.  
  • Listening Posts: These are already fast becoming the new eye and ears of office life. They enable organizations to capture survey feedback immediately in the flow of work, identifying points of improvement to generate better employee experiences. 
  • Journey Accelerator: It helps managers create personalized and consistent plans for their employees, enabling them to be more productive at every stage of their journey, including onboarding, transfers, and promotions. 

Despite plans around the world for lockdown easing and office re-openings this summer, the ‘in-the-moment’ offering for listening posts is a sure sign that ServiceNow believes remote, or hybrid, working is here to stay.
